Creative ideas for unique wall decor

When it comes to unique wall decor, there are countless creative ideas you can explore. Using recycled materials opens up a world of possibilities that allow for personal expression and innovation. Whether you prefer a minimalist style or something more eclectic, there’s something here for everyone.

1. Mosaic Art from Broken Tiles

Take broken tiles or colorful pieces of glass and create stunning mosaic designs. Arrange them into patterns, shapes, or specific images that reflect your personality. This style can brighten up any wall while showcasing creativity and craftsmanship.

2. Fabric Wall Hangings

Using old fabrics or clothing, you can craft beautiful wall hangings. Cut the fabric into shapes, layer them, and attach them to a wooden frame. This not only adds texture to your space but also incorporates colorful patterns.

  • Try different fabric types for variety.
  • Use natural fibers like cotton or burlap for a rustic feel.
  • Add embellishments like beads or buttons for extra flair.

Such pieces can become conversation starters and are a great way to repurpose old clothing.

3. Nature-Inspired Art

If you’re a fan of the outdoors, consider creating wall decor from natural elements. Use fallen branches, leaves, or even petals to create a nature-inspired display. You can frame dried leaves in shadow boxes or make a 3D art piece with twigs and stones. This gives a fresh and organic feel to your home.

4. Recycled Paper Art

Another great idea is to create art from recycled paper. Roll old newspapers into beads for a stunning necklace display or cut images from magazines to form a collage. This technique not only enhances the aesthetic but is also eco-conscious.

Tips for sourcing materials sustainably

Tips for sourcing materials sustainably

Sourcing materials sustainably for your DIY wall art projects is an important step in embracing eco-friendly creativity. Finding the right materials can make your art unique while helping the environment. Here are some effective tips to guide you.

1. Explore Thrift Stores

Thrift stores are treasure troves for finding affordable and interesting items. You can discover fabrics, frames, and even decor items that can be repurposed into art. Going through these shops not only supports recycling but also supports local charities.

2. Check Your Recycling Bin

Before you throw anything away, take a peek into your recycling bin. Items like cardboard, paper, and glass can all be transformed into beautiful pieces of art. By using these materials, you prevent waste and give them a new life.

  • Old newspapers can be used for collage art.
  • Cardboard boxes can become creative sculptures.
  • Glass jars can be transformed into candle holders.

Such repurposing is fun and helps minimize landfill waste, making it a win-win situation.

3. Participate in Community Swaps

Community swaps are another great way to source materials sustainably. Organizing or joining a swap event allows you to exchange items you no longer need for supplies other participants have to offer. It’s a fantastic way to connect with others in your area and gather unique materials.

4. Utilize Nature

Don’t overlook the beauty of natural materials. Collect twigs, leaves, stones, or flowers for your artwork. These elements can add a distinctive touch to your creations. When gathering natural materials, be sure to do so responsibly and respect local regulations.

FAQ – Frequently Asked Questions about DIY Wall Art with Recycled Materials

What types of recycled materials can I use for DIY wall art?

You can use items like old newspapers, cardboard, broken tiles, fabric scraps, glass jars, and natural elements like twigs and leaves.

How can I source materials sustainably for my projects?

You can visit thrift stores, check your recycling bin, participate in community swaps, or gather natural materials from your surroundings.

Are there any specific techniques for creating mosaic art?

Yes! Begin by breaking tiles into smaller pieces, then arrange them into patterns on a base, using adhesive to secure them in place.

Can I sell the artwork I create from recycled materials?

Absolutely! Many people appreciate the uniqueness and eco-friendliness of recycled art, making it a great option for selling at local markets or online.
